Our story
Founded in 2017, our rescue has been a safe haven for countless dogs in need. We started with a simple goal: to provide a sanctuary where dogs can live happily without the constraints of cages.
Little Moon Rescue is a heartwarming haven located in the countryside near Málaga, Spain. Our family-driven non-profit association is dedicated to rescuing, rehabilitating, and living their best lives. We believe that every dog deserves a safe and caring environment and work tirelessly to make that a reality. We provide a safe haven for dogs facing abandonment, mistreatment, or other unfortunate circumstances. We offer personalized care, focusing on building trust and helping each dog heal.
We are fortunate to live in a beautiful part of the world, but like everywhere, we face our share of animal welfare challenges. Choosing to step up and help brings its own set of obstacles, but our dedication to making a difference fuels our resolve.

tim Wass MBE
Co-Founder & Vice President
Tim is Little Moon’s co founder and VP. Following service in the RAF, Tim joined the Royal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(RSPCA), where he specialised in complex cruelty investigations.
He rose through the ranks to become the Chief Officer of the Inspectorate. Tim led the organisation’s response to several national and international animal welfare and health crisis, for which he was made an MBE. Tim went on to become an Independent Animal Welfare Consultant for many organisations and charities in different parts of the world
